King Leopold's ghost : a story of greed, terror and heroism in colonial Africa
Hochschild, Adam, 1942-2019
Book
When Edmund Morel realised that Belgium's colony the Congo was exploiting slave labour, he quit his job and single-handedly made the Congo's slave labour regime and the millions of lives it took into a cause which would unite the whole world.
